According to a report from L’Équipe, Tottenham Hotspur have opened discussions with AS Monaco over a transfer for Folarin Balogun (25), with the French outlet writing that the striker is estimated to be worth around €60m.
Balogun is coming off his third season in the Principality, having moved to the Ligue 1 side from Tottenham’s rivals Arsenal in 2023. The US international has been linked this summer with an exit. Spanish and English sides (including Newcastle United) have reportedly held an interest in a striker, who scored 19 times across 45 games last season.
